- Introduced comprehensive mock for the Origin Private File System (OPFS) in `tests/mocks/opfs-mock.ts`, simulating environment for detailed storage testing. - Added `tests/opfs-storage.test.ts`, containing extensive test cases for `OPFSStorage` operations including metadata, nouns, verbs, and storage status. - Improved S3 mock implementation in `tests/mocks/s3-mock.ts` with better object persistence, validation, and logging to emulate real S3 behavior. - Resolved issues related to metadata, nouns, verbs, and storage usage inconsistencies in mock storage adapters. - Enhanced logging and error handling to aid in debugging and test reliability. Purpose: Improve test completeness and reliability by introducing detailed mocks and extended test cases for S3 and OPFS storage systems.
